n 1: a tingling feeling of excitement (as from teasing or
tickling)
2: an agreeable arousal
3: the act of tickling [syn: tickle, tickling,
titillation]
We value your privacy. We use cookies to improve your experience and serve personalized ads through Google AdSense.
By clicking "Accept," you consent to our use of cookies and third-party advertising.
Learn more